It took about an hour and a half on each end renting and returning, and maybe a half hour entering the information. The actual work end of it was fairly easy. I would say it was about 4 hours over two days. I live close to the airport and know my way around it very well so it wasn't very difficult.

There are a million parking lots around my airport, all are close, and all have a free shuttle back and forth so that was fairly easy, and they claim to reimburse parking.

After reading the guidelines of this shop, the only issues that I would have are whether the parking for costs for the three cars are reimbursed. Btemps is fortunate that he lives by an the airport and knows where to park, yet for the novice shopper, would it be safe to say that they may use the airport parking lot that can be anywhere from $12-18 per day? At maximum costs, that's $54 for an overnight. If Intelli-shop doesn't reimburse (I'm assuming that they do), then you are looking at a $46 or $50 shop for 2 days of work.
